Pinsent is a surname. Notable people with the surname include:

  • Cecil Pinsent (5 May 1884 – 5 December 1963), British garden designer and architect
  • David Pinsent (1891 – May 1918), friend and collaborator of the Austrian philosopher Ludwig Wittgenstein
  • Ed Pinsent (born 1960), English cartoonist, artist and writer
  • Dame Ellen Pinsent DBE (1866–1949), British mental health worker
  • Gordon Pinsent, CC, FRSC (1930–2023), Canadian television, theatre and film actor
  • Hester Pinsent, DBE (1899–1966), British mental health worker
  • John Pinsent (1922–1995), English classical scholar
  • Leah Pinsent (born 1968), Canadian television and film actress
  • Sir Matthew Pinsent, CBE (born 1970), English rowing champion, Olympic gold medallist, and broadcaster
  • Robert John Pinsent (1797–1876), magistrate and politician
  • Zack Pinsent (born c. 1994), British costumer
